8-K: 8x8 Appoints New Chief Accounting Officer, Grants RSUs

Sentiment:

Current Report (8-K)


8x8, Inc. announced the appointment of Colleen Martin-Garcia as Senior Vice President and Chief Accounting Officer, effective July 29, 2026, and approved an award of 600,000 restricted stock units.

Summary

  • 8x8, Inc. has appointed Colleen Martin-Garcia as its new Senior Vice President and Chief Accounting Officer, effective July 29, 2026.
  • Ms. Martin-Garcia, who joined the company on July 6, 2026, will assume the principal accounting officer role, previously held by CFO Kevin Kraus.
  • Mr. Kraus will return to his primary role as Chief Financial Officer and principal financial officer.
  • The company's Compensation Committee approved an award of 600,000 restricted stock units (RSUs) to Ms. Martin-Garcia.
  • These RSUs will vest over three years, with one-third vesting on the first anniversary of the grant date and the remainder vesting quarterly thereafter.
  • The RSUs are expected to be granted in September 2026.
  • Ms. Martin-Garcia's annual base salary will be $360,000 with a target annual cash bonus of 50% of her base salary.
  • There are no disclosed family relationships or related party transactions involving Ms. Martin-Garcia.
